Marcia Moshé to continue as interim vice-provost, academic

Role includes planning and implementing key academic initiatives

I am writing to inform the community that Marcia Moshé, interim vice-provost, academic, will be extended in her role to Dec. 31, 2017. 

Marcia has served in this role since Dec. 1, 2015 playing a lead role in planning and implementing key academic initiatives such as the renewal of Ryerson's undergraduate curriculum model and the review of five academic policies. She has also provided excellent leadership in chairing the Academic Standards Committee, the Curriculum Implementation Committee and co-chairing the Academic Policy Review Committee. She has also overseen the Office of Academic Integrity, the Experiential Learning Office, the Learning & Teaching Office, and Curriculum Quality Assurance.

I would like to thank Marcia for accepting the extension. I am confident that she will continue to provide visionary leadership for her portfolio and the university.

Michael Benarroch
Provost and Vice-President, Academic
